Ok guys, i finally got my wiikey fusion cable (thanks _nold_!)
I hooked everything up, checked the dip switches and i get a red light on wiikey fusion board as well as a warning on the screen telling me to power down and refer to my user manual.
Has anyone come across this problem before? and what should be my next course of action to fix it?

Red light usually means something is going wrong, i.e. not enough power or no power at certain pins, or the eject/switch. Double check all connections visually and with a multimeter I guess - also ask Nold if he'd tested it prior to sending (pretty sure he would have though).
Are you putting it the right way in the slot?
